A főbb algoritmikus struktúrák - studopediya

1. A lineáris algoritmus.

Algoritmus, amely az utasítás végrehajtása egymás után, az úgynevezett lineáris algoritmus.

3. példa Két egészek x és y. Kiszámítására és megjelenik a monitoron a függvény értékét. Hozzon létre egy algoritmust a probléma megoldására a természetes nyelv és a forma egy blokk diagram.

1) az algoritmus természetes nyelven:

4. A kijelző a képernyőn z értéke

2) formájában egy blokk diagram:

A főbb algoritmikus struktúrák - studopediya

3) A Visual Basic programozási nyelv (1. függelék)

2. Az algoritmikus szerkezet „elágazó”.

A algoritmikus szerkezete „elágazó” vagy, hogy egy sor végrehajtott parancsok, a körülményektől függően az igazság.

A főbb algoritmikus struktúrák - studopediya

3. Az algoritmikus szerkezete „Choice”

A algoritmikus szerkezete „kiválasztási” végeztünk egy több parancs szekvenciák adott esetben igazságfeltételeit.

A főbb algoritmikus struktúrák - studopediya

4. példa Adott egy x szám. Kiszámítására és megjelenik a monitoron a függvény értékét. Hozzon létre egy algoritmust a probléma megoldására a természetes nyelv és a forma egy blokk diagram.

1) az algoritmus természetes nyelven:

3. Ha x<0, то идти к 5

4. Ha X = 0, akkor megy 9

Hozzárendelése 5. y 1

7. y hozzárendelni -1

9. y hozzárendelni 0

10 monitoron megjelenő értéke y

2) formájában egy blokk diagram:

A főbb algoritmikus struktúrák - studopediya

3) A Visual Basic programozási nyelv (2. függelék)

4. Az algoritmikus szerkezet „ciklus”

Az algoritmikus szerkezet „hurok” parancs (hurok) ismételten végrehajtásra.

A ciklus számláló

A főbb algoritmikus struktúrák - studopediya

Cycles azzal a feltétellel,

A főbb algoritmikus struktúrák - studopediya

5. példa Compute és megjeleníti az értéket a funkciót, ha a változó x intervallumban [a; b] fokozatonként h. Hozzon létre egy algoritmust a probléma megoldására a természetes nyelv és a forma egy blokk diagram.

1) az algoritmus természetes nyelven:

3. x hozzárendelése a

5. A kijelző a képernyőn az értékeket az x és y

6. x rendelni x + H

7. Ha x≤b. akkor megy 4

2) formájában egy blokk diagram:

3) A Visual Basic programozási nyelv (3. melléklet)

6. példa Compute és megjeleníti az összege az első k kifejezéseket, amelyek nem haladják meg az értéket a 10-es számú (i- természetes egész szám). Hozzon létre egy algoritmust a probléma megoldására a természetes nyelv és a forma egy blokk diagram.

1) az algoritmus természetes nyelven:

2. i rendelni 0

3. S rendelni 0

5. Ismételje meg, amíg a ≤ 10

5.1. Hozzárendelése S S + egy

5.2. i rendelt i + 1

6. megjelenik a monitoron S értéke

2), mint egy blokk-séma:

A főbb algoritmikus struktúrák - studopediya

3) A Visual Basic programozási nyelv (4. függelék)

Kapcsolódó cikkek